About The Position

Under general direction, is responsible for coordinating and conducting contract initiation, monitoring or compliance activities, in accordance with the City's contracting policies and procedures. May exercise supervision over assigned staff.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university.
  • Three (3) years of increasingly responsible experience in contract management, preparation, or compliance.
  • Valid Class "C" Texas Driver's License.
  • Ability to operate a computer keyboard and other basic office equipment.
  • Skill in utilizing a personal computer and associated software programs.
  • Ability to understand contract management data, documents, and reports.
  • Ability to understand and interpret financial and cost accounting data.
  • Ability to work independently and perform contract services projects from inception to completion.
  • Ability to communicate effectively.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with co-workers, City Management and their staff, vendors and contract service providers, and the general public.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ality of information.
  • Ability to perform all the intellectual and analytical requirements of the position, including decision-making.

Responsibilities

  • Implements the practices and procedures established for contract initiation, monitoring, or compliance.
  • Performs initiation, monitoring, or compliance activities for City contracts.
  • Prepares detailed written reports and presentations regarding contracting projects.
  • Performs special reviews, projects, and programs, and may prepare Requests for Proposals (RFP's).
  • Provides technical assistance and direction regarding contract compliance.
  • Provides staff support as required for special projects.
  • Performs related duties and responsibilities as required.
  • Provides direction to staff regarding improvements to contracting procedures.
  • Supervises staff and gives direction regarding contract compliance issues and related matters.
  • Oversees all negotiations, terminations, and renegotiations of contracts.
  • Approves or rejects requests for deviations from contract specifications and delivery schedules.
  • Develops contract compliance work plans and objectives.
  • Conducts presentations regarding contracting projects.
